Small update.

With latest update Youtube in browser doesn't crash anymore but you can still get occasional "this video not available on this device" messages.

I found that going into settings and setting "user-agent" to iPad fixes it. Sites start thinking you're on tablet and give you touch optimized layout and you will start getting all the videos you want.
